Responsibilities

  • Calculate accurate and insightful performance metrics for open-end funds, closed-end funds and separately managed accounts
  • Provide oversight of third-party administrators, while liaising internally with teams such as Portfolio Management, Product Strategy, Fund Controllers
  • Demonstrate subject matter expertise in the day-to-day performance oversight function to ensure timely and accurate delivery of performance for usage in reporting
  • Ensure a robust control environment exists both at the fund service providers and internally to mitigate risk of errors
  • Drive increased efficiency and control through continuous review of operating procedures; evaluate and implement technology improvements in partnership with dedicated Technology teams
  • Support internal and external partners’ ad-hoc requests - provide status updates and appropriately manage expectations
  • Responsible for compliance with performance-related requirements from regulatory authorities
  • Follow up on incidents including root-cause analysis as well as proposing and overseeing the implementation of solutions to reduce future occurrences
  • Participate in the product onboarding and lifecycle change process, to drive key decisions relating to performance
